Mount Uhud is a famous historical landmark that Muslim desire to visit during their journey. It is located in the northern part of Madinah in Saudi Arabia, is an ancient peak with an elevation of 3533 feet. The mountaintop is well-known for being the site of the second conflict between pagans as well as Muslims.

Nowadays, visitors and pilgrims from all over the globe explore the hill to witness its cultural and religious significance. This peak features historical relics, such as a magnificent mosque in the valley. Tourists may also participate in a variety of exhilarating sports including rock climbing and trekking.

Historical Background of Mount Uhud

The peak is well-known for serving as the site of the pivotal battle of Uhud. The conflict predated the Battle of Badr and constituted the second military encounter between Muslims and Meccans. It occurred when the Meccans sought to revenge for their failure at the Battle of Badr by launching an aggressive attack against the army headed by Prophet Mohammad (P.B.U.H). The general outcome of the battle appeared to favor Muslims, but a critical miscalculation on the side of the Muslim army reversed the outcome of the war. Several Muslims in the invasion force of Prophet Mohammad (P.B.U.H) defied him by abandoning their positions. As a result, Meccan armies from their infantry launched an unexpected strike. Numerous people were killed in this surprise onslaught, especially the Prophet's (P.B.U.H) foster brother as well as uncle. The conflict also resulted in the injury of Prophet Muhammad (P.B.U.H).

Some Facts About Mount Uhud

The following are some of the facts about this miraculous mountain:

  • ¾ Directions were issued to 50 archers to set themselves on the mountaintop. The idea was that it would keep Muslims secure even if the enemy (or disbelievers) assaulted them from behind.
  • ¾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) instructed his soldiers not to vacate their position until commanded to do so.
  • ¾ On the day of battle, the Prophet (P.B.U.H) is claimed to have said the Duhr prayer at this location.
  • ¾ The Mount of Uhud has the destroyed remnants of a mosque.

The Miracle of Mount Uhud

When Prophet Mohammad (P.B.U.H) was ascending Mount Uhud with Umar, Uthman, and Abu Bakar, the mountain earth trembled underneath them. That's when Prophet (P.B.U.H) stomped his foot on the surface and said, "O Uhud! Stay steadfast, for upon you there is a Prophet, a true supporter, and two martyrs on your side. As a result, the earthquake came to a halt instantaneously. Because the Mount of Uhud is so dear to Prophet Mohammad's (P.B.U.H) heart, there are several hadiths on it and the most well-known is, this is the mountain that we love and that loves us. This exhibits the Prophet's affection for the location and expresses people's love for the mountain as well. The one who loves Hazrat Muhammad (S.A.W) will love everything that he loves.

A Quick Tour to Mount Uhud Ziyarat

Mount Uhud has a particular spot in the hearts of Muslims since it was the scene of the second significant war in Islamic civilization. Visitors flock to the hill to enjoy the mystic and aesthetic splendor of the area. The area has grown tremendously throughout the years as a result of the steady growth in pilgrims and travelers entering the vicinity. It is home to a number of eateries and diners that provide genuine Saudi and foreign food in a lovely setting. Municipal Bukhari Restaurant, ZamZam Kerala, Indian, Chinese, Arabic family Restaurant, Barger Restaurant, as well as Green Ribbon Restaurant are among several of the area's renowned eateries.

Mount Uhud is 13 kilometers from Madinah's city Centre. It is also 10 kilometers north of Masjid an Nabwi. The hill is well-served by highways and public transportation. Tourists may also arrange private taxis for a more customized mountainside experience. What Is the Best Time to Explore This Majestic Uhud Mount?

Mount Uhud is the most prominent Ziyarat destination in Madinah, visited by the majority of Hajj as well as Umrah pilgrims. Because the location has a sandy environment, winters are the best season to explore Mount Uhud. The months of November to April are by far the most preferred ones for visitors.
